THE EOS PHILOSOPHY

Every dawn, the world is made new. So is good furniture.


Eos, the Greek Goddess of the Dawn, rose each morning to open the gates for the sun. We think of our work the same way; solid wood pieces built to last a century deserve more than a landfill at year forty. They deserve a dawn.

We find pieces with real bones: dovetailed drawers, quarter-sawn oak, walnut that's only gotten richer with age. Then we strip, repair, and refinish each one by hand in our Twin Falls workshop, using professional-grade finishing equipment and two decades of trade craftsmanship.

No two pieces are alike, and none is repeated. When it's gone, it's gone.We source vintage and antique furniture with history worth preserving — pieces that have lived, and have more living to do.

Every restoration is approached with patience. We strip back only what must go, repair what can be saved, and finish with professional-grade materials that last another generation.

Eos is a studio operating out of Twin Falls, Idaho. No shortcuts. No production lines. Just honest work done by real people.

THE COLLECTION

One of one. Numbered, always.

Every finished piece is hand-stamped with a number - a record that it exists once, was restored once, and belongs to one home.

No. 001 — The Octave.
A 1930s solid oak side table with twin octagonal tiers, stripped and refinished by hand in a medium neutral tone that lets the grain do the talking.

No. 002 — The Ember.
A pine side table in two voices: natural medium-brown top, deep oxblood base, twin drawers with beautiful, 10” aged brass pulls.

No. 003 — The Sentinel.
A 1920s–30s Jacobean Revival walnut side table. Hexagonal, deeply carved, and finished in dark walnut the way it was always meant to be. They don't carve like this anymore.

THE PROCESS

How a piece is reborn


i · The Find

Sourced with intent

We are always on the hunt for new pieces. Whether that is at estate sales, auctions, or 2nd hand stores, we travel across the Magic Valley and beyond looking for pieces with honest construction and character worth saving.


ii · The Work

Restored by trade hands

Repairs made, damage repaired properly, then stripped and refinished with professional spray equipment and finishes chosen for the wood, not the trend.


iii · The Dawn

Numbered and released

Each piece is photographed, tagged with its number, and offered once. Local pickup and delivery available throughout Twin Falls and the surrounding valley.
